For Immediate Release:
Bobcats AAA Program
February 3, 2011
Phoenix, Arizona: “Building from the back up is always a good thing in hockey, this is why the return of Trip Hutchinson as the 98 AAA Bobcats goalie represents so much.” commented Head Coach Ron Filion. “Trip has been with us since we started the 98 group, and not once has he ever disappointed the coaching staff or his teammates. He loves big games and plays in them, which gives us a solid chance to win. He drives me nuts at times before the games but he is a great kid and is very easy to coach. Working with him this winter was also a blast” said Filion.

January 7, 2010
Phoenix, Arizona: Tripp Hutchinson has announced his return in net for the Bobcats 98 AAA team. His return represents a huge step in the right direction for the program. Tripp’s performance last season was very impressive; by doing so, he showed he could lead any AAA program.
“The kid was just phenomenal last year, it was a no brainer to select our first goalie--lucky for us, he wanted to come back” said Filion. “Before our first game last year we had to rush him to get dressed, he was just hanging out taking is time; it made me a little nervous. After that first period, I turned to my assistants and told them we should maybe leave him alone, he was playing great” said Filion “Having a goalie that gives you a chance to compete every game is a huge advantage, this is what he did for us last season” concluded Coach Ron.
